Spring & Fall Cleanups

Two essential touchpoints in the Cape Cod calendar — each with a different purpose.

Spring Cleanup

Late March – April

Clears winter debris and resets the property for the growing season.

  • Removal of winter debris and storm damage
  • Gutter cleaning
  • Garden bed cleanout
  • Dethatching
  • Edging beds and walkways
  • Optional mulch installation
  • First mow of the season

Fall Cleanup

Late October – mid-November

Clears leaves and prepares the property to overwinter cleanly.

  • Multi-pass leaf removal and blowing
  • Final mowing at proper winter height
  • Garden bed clearing and tidying
  • Removal of fallen branches and debris
  • Hauling of all yard waste

When should I schedule my spring cleanup? +
Spring cleanups on Cape Cod typically run from late March through April, once the ground has thawed and snow has fully melted. Booking early is recommended — the spring window is short and our schedule fills quickly.
When should I schedule my fall cleanup? +
Fall cleanups are usually done from late October through mid-November, after most leaves have dropped but before the first hard frost. Many properties benefit from a multi-pass approach as leaves come down in waves.
Do I really need both a spring and fall cleanup? +
For most Cape Cod properties, yes. Spring cleanup clears winter debris and prepares your lawn and beds for the growing season. Fall cleanup prevents leaves from suffocating turf, keeps the property tidy through winter, and saves you a much bigger job come spring.
